Friday night and into Saturday we picked up roughly 2 feet of heavy wet lake effect snow. Much of the day on Saturday was spent cleaning up here at the shop and anglers reported that some of the parking lots finally got cleared later in the afternoon. Over the next couple of days we are expected to go into a warming trend with the temperature reaching into the 40's. With the low water conditions the fish have been holding in and around the deeper holes and larger runs. For those anglers who are fly fishing, dead drifitng with nymphs, indicator fishing with egg patterns or swinging small streamers with sink tips have all produced results. For those anglers who are bottom bouncing or float fishing, egg sacs and beads have produced the best results. Depending on the day anglers have been getting into fish in the Lower Fly Fishing Zone, Schoolhouse area, Trestle Pool area, Pineville area, Sportsman Pool area, Staircase/Longbridge, Black Hole and the DSR.

Suggested patterns:
Eggs: estaz eggs, steelie omelet, glo-bugs, sucker spawn.
Streamers: Egg sucking leeches, flesh flies, woolly buggers.
Nymphs: Steelhead hammer, beadhead stones, rubber legged stones
